The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details
ST 93 SE TEFFONT WYLYE ROAD (east side)
1/188 Spring Cottage
GV II
Detached cottage. C16 and C17, left bay is C17 addition. Rubble stone, thatched roof, brick stacks. T-plan. Single-storey and attic, 3 windows. Planked door left of centre, two 2-light and two 3-light casements. Attic has one 3-light casement below raised eaves of left bay, two full dormers with coped verges to right, one with 3-light recessed chamfered mullioned window and one with 3- light casement. Roof has coped verge to right. Left return has blocked chamfered light. Rear has 3-light and 2-light casements with C20 dormer to attic, rear wing to right has 2-light and 3- light casements. Interior has two open fireplaces, the north one has chamfered lintel with rounded corners on stone jambs, the south fireplace has renewed lintel, deeply chamfered beams with stepped stops, planked doors with strap hinges. Rear wall, now within wing, has blocked 3-light wooden mullioned window. First floor has chamfered wooden doorcase, with stops. Four-bay roof has one tier of heavy through purlins, the centre bay is charred and smoke-blackened, suggesting a cottage open to the roof, probably C16, floor inserted C17.
